THE POSITION
The Protocol Manager is responsible for the definition, development, and implementation of the Protocol strategy for the FIFA Women’s World Cup 2027™.
The role focuses on the planning, coordination, and delivery of high-level Protocol services for VVIP/VIP guests and dignitaries, including liaison with government authorities, embassies, and official delegations.
The Protocol Manager ensures the establishment of Protocol guidelines, processes, and service standards, and oversees their consistent application across all official FIFA event sites, in alignment with FIFA expectations.
Reporting to the Senior Guest Operations Manager, the role acts as the key point of reference for all Protocol-related matters and represents the function to both internal and external stakeholders.
KEY RESPONSIBILITIES
  • Define the overall Protocol strategy, including guest group segmentation and corresponding levels of Protocol services.
  • Develop and implement Protocol guidelines, policies, and decision-making frameworks (e.g. VVIP seating principles, order of precedence).
  • Lead the planning and delivery of Protocol services for VVIP/VIP guests and dignitaries across all official FIFA event sites.
  • Act as the key liaison with government authorities, embassies, and official delegations before and during the tournament.
  • Oversee interactions with high-ranking guests, ensuring compliance with Protocol standards and expectations.
  • Define and coordinate Protocol requirements across venues, including VVIP/VIP seating, lounges, drop-off zones, and guest flows.
  • Provide guidance and supervision to the Protocol team and coordinate with external partners and guest Protocol representatives.
  • Oversee Protocol-related services, including seating planning, forms of address, ceremonial arrangements, and official welcoming procedures.
  • Collaborate with FIFA Zurich and relevant functional areas to ensure alignment of Protocol services with overall Guest Operations delivery.
  • Establish and maintain strong relationships with internal and external stakeholders.
  • Attend site visits and inspections.

What We Do

FIFA (Fédération Internationale de Football Association) is the international governing body for association football, futsal, and beach soccer. It is responsible for organizing major international tournaments, such as the World Cup, and works to grow the game globally, promote inclusivity, and advocate for integrity and fair play. Headquartered in Zurich, Switzerland, it oversees 211 national associations and invests in football development worldwide to ensure the sport remains accessible and beneficial to all.
